Output 57e077d129995f8008a93a5439e789d2f67aeab67280d46faac827f6d08674d7:5

value
221160
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b060a02f73458e5769c88aa46d4b956bbabb8a29 OP_EQUAL
address
3HmcbyjKAHPmhuttJBD8e1c18KMrybsxmz
transaction
57e077d129995f8008a93a5439e789d2f67aeab67280d46faac827f6d08674d7
confirmations
335759
spent
true